Hello,

I'm re-building a graphic interface for the 4th time and it seems every 
approach is problematic.

To make it brief, you create/drag graphic objects made of one centered 
circle and one circle for the adjustable radius. Nothing fancy.

- Java UI : tremondously cpu hungry. Event handling is a nightmare
- Java based external sending messages to an LCD : less hungry but still 
unacceptable for realtime. Event handling still a nightmare
- C external sending messages to an LCD : very very good performances 
BUT i am limited to the LCD features (no alpha channel). Event handling 
still a nightmare
- JSui : Very handy event handling. Lots of drawing features. 
Antialiasing. Alpha channel. Unfortunately, tremondously cpu hungry.

I know my code is dirty at this point, but i've watched the same cpu 
spikes using technoui so i suspect it's JSui's law.

Is there anyway to have a sprite behavior in JSui (like in LCD) ? Or do 
i have to redraw all my things when i just want to move one without 
leaving traces behind (erase / redraw everything when you just change 
one thing) ?

This second solution seems to lead to HUUUUGE CPU usage (sometimes 100% 
of one core) when you got several things to draw.

At the time i'm writing, i have only 4 circles objects on my scene, and 
trying to change ones color continuously with a color swatch and a very 
simple frgb function (like you have in any jsui examples) makes my mouse 
stutter and my cpu goes to the clouds...

Max 4.6.3 / XP SP2 / DualCore 2.16Ghz / NVIDIA GeForce Go 7800 GTX
